Table of Contents
Data Dictionary Best Practices (2026 Guide)
Data dictionary best practices define how organizations document, standardize, and govern data definitions across systems. A strong data dictionary provides clear metadata, consistent terminology, and shared context for every data field. These practices improve data quality, support governance, and reduce reporting inconsistencies. Effective data dictionaries align definitions with business rules, maintain version history, and stay up to date as systems change. Teams use a well-managed data dictionary to improve trust, ensure compliance, and make accurate, informed decisions at scale.
At any fast-growing organization, the biggest challenge is not data volume or tooling. The real challenge is understanding what the data actually means. Some core terms like customer, active user, and revenue carry different definitions across teams. As a result, reports conflict, projects stall, and confidence in analytics steadily declines.
This situation is common in organizations that lack a clear and well-managed data dictionary. Without consistent definitions, even strong data infrastructure produces unreliable outcomes. Metrics lose alignment, reporting becomes questionable, and decision-making suffers.
It is essential to follow certain best practices to address this problem at its root. This guide focuses on practical approaches to implementing, maintaining, and scaling a data dictionary that strengthens clarity, restores trust in data, and supports well-informed decisions across the organization.
Data dictionary implementation best practices
A well-maintained data dictionary is foundational to strong data governance. It ensures every stakeholder, whether technical or business, has a common understanding of data definitions, source systems, calculation logic, and usage guidelines.
Below are essential data dictionary best practices that help organizations standardize documentation, improve data quality, and enforce clarity across data ecosystems.

1. Align with data governance and business goals
A data dictionary is not just a catalog of field names and formats. It is the mechanism by which data definitions are standardized, made transparent, and aligned with business priorities.
Most failed governance initiatives didn’t lack tools. They lacked agreement on definitions. Without a shared understanding of key terms, even the most advanced data stack fails to produce trustworthy or consistent outcomes.
When data definitions are inconsistent or disconnected from business use cases, teams end up working in silos, making conflicting assumptions about the same data point.
This undermines both strategic alignment and decision-making accuracy. A properly implemented data dictionary prevents these conflicts by ensuring that each term is vetted, standardized, and explicitly connected to business logic and compliance requirements.
To put this into practice:
-
Start by identifying data elements tied to critical business functions, such as financial reporting, regulatory filings, and operational KPIs.
-
Document not just the field name and type, but also calculation methods, applicable exclusions, data lineage, and usage notes.
-
Define stewardship responsibilities so that domain experts are accountable for keeping definitions current and reflective of evolving goals.
By integrating the data dictionary into your governance framework, you improve cross-functional clarity, reduce the risk of misreporting, and create a solid foundation for scalable analytics and audit readiness.
2. Embed the data dictionary into daily workflows
Creating a robust data dictionary is only half the battle. The real value emerges when it becomes a daily reference point across teams. Too often, data dictionaries sit unused in isolated tools or shared folders, disconnected from the daily workflows.
This disconnect leads to guesswork, duplication of logic, and data quality issues.
According to a 2024 Gartner Report on the Future State of D & A Governance, 80% of data governance initiatives will fail by 2027 if they remain isolated from business outcomes or embedded workflows.
Embedding the dictionary into daily workflows means meeting users where they are. Analysts should be able to see definitions inside their BI tools, whether they’re working in dashboards, writing queries, or analyzing trends.
Developers and data engineers should have direct access while designing schemas or building pipelines, ensuring consistency in how fields are used across systems.
To make this actionable:
-
Integrate definitions into reporting platforms and analytics tools through overlays or API connections.
-
Include links to relevant terms directly in data model documentation and tickets during development sprints.
-
Make dictionary access part of team onboarding and project initiation processes, so new members understand shared terminology from day one.
When the dictionary is embedded into routine operations, it transforms from static documentation into a living, collaborative asset that actively supports better decisions.
3. Assign clear ownership and accessibility
When no one is responsible for a data element, definitions quickly become outdated, and if the ownership is unclear, the data dictionary will decay.
Ownership ensures accountability, but effective ownership goes beyond assigning a name to a field. It defines who approves changes, who validates accuracy, and who answers questions when definitions are unclear.
In practice, ownership works best when it is aligned with domain expertise. Business-critical fields such as revenue, customer status, or eligibility flags should be owned by the teams that understand their real-world meaning and impact.
This prevents situations where technical teams maintain definitions that no longer reflect how the business actually uses the data. Without this alignment, organizations often face conflicting interpretations during reporting reviews or audits.
When data definitions are maintained by those closest to the business context, the data dictionary becomes a trusted reference rather than a static document that people work around.
4. Standardize naming conventions
Standardizing naming conventions is a foundational data dictionary best practice that directly improves clarity and efficiency.
Effective naming conventions are predictable, descriptive, and aligned with how the business thinks about data. A field name should immediately signal what the data represents, not just how it is stored.
|
For example, a metric labeled total_users should have a single, well-documented meaning that applies consistently across dashboards, models, and reports. If another team uses active_users to describe the same concept, the dictionary should clarify whether these terms are equivalent or intentionally different. |
Standardization becomes even more important as organizations scale and add new systems. Without shared conventions, teams may create duplicate fields that represent the same data under different names, increasing technical debt and reporting inconsistencies.
Clear rules around prefixes, suffixes, and abbreviations help prevent this fragmentation and make data models easier to navigate.
By standardizing names and documenting them clearly in the data dictionary, organizations reduce ambiguity, improve cross-team understanding, and create a more scalable and maintainable data environment.
5. Provide clear definitions and context
Most data issues arise because people misunderstand how a data element is calculated, where it originates, or how it is intended to be used. Data dictionary best practices focus on eliminating this ambiguity by documenting both meaning and context.
A strong definition should answer several questions at once. It should explain the business meaning in plain language, outline the calculation logic or derivation rules, identify the source system, and clarify when the field should or should not be used.
|
For example, a metric labeled active_user can be interpreted very differently depending on whether it includes trial users, internal accounts, or inactive logins. Stating these rules explicitly prevents misaligned dashboards and conflicting analyses. |
Context also matters over time. Business logic changes, products evolve, and definitions that once made sense can become outdated.
Including usage notes and change history helps users understand why a definition exists in its current form and whether it is appropriate for their use case.
This is especially important for shared metrics that appear in executive reporting, regulatory submissions, or cross-functional dashboards.
Best practices for clear definitions include:
-
Writing definitions in business language first, with technical details layered underneath.
-
Documenting calculation rules, exclusions, and dependencies explicitly.
-
Including source systems and transformation logic to support traceability.
-
Adding usage guidance so users know when a field is appropriate and when it is not.
When definitions are clear and contextual, the data dictionary becomes a trusted reference rather than a glossary that still leaves room for interpretation.
6. Implement version control to track changes
In many organizations, reporting discrepancies are traced back to silent definition changes. A calculation is adjusted, an exclusion is added, or a source system is replaced, but the original definition is overwritten without context.
When this happens, analysts and business users have no way to understand whether a difference in results reflects a real business change or a documentation gap. Version control solves this problem by preserving history rather than rewriting it.
Effective versioning captures what changed, when it changed, and why it changed. This includes updates to business logic, source systems, calculation methods, and usage guidance.
Maintaining a change log alongside each definition allows users to trace the evolution of a data element and assess whether older reports or models are still comparable.
This is especially important for regulated reporting, financial analysis, and long-term trend analysis, where historical consistency matters.
Strong practices for version control in a data dictionary include:
-
Recording all definition changes with timestamps and clear descriptions.
-
Linking changes to approval workflows or governance decisions.
-
Allowing users to view previous versions to support audits and investigations.
-
Communicating significant updates so downstream users can adjust their analyses.
When version control is built into the data dictionary, it reinforces transparency and accountability. Teams spend less time reconciling conflicting numbers and more time focusing on insights.
How to maintain a data dictionary over time
Maintaining a data dictionary is not a one-time task. It is a continuous process that ensures definitions remain accurate, relevant, and aligned with business needs.
Strong maintenance practices are critical to preserving the integrity and usefulness of your metadata documentation.
1. Define a regular review cadence
Without active upkeep, even the most well-built data dictionaries lose value quickly. As systems evolve, data pipelines shift, and business logic changes, outdated definitions introduce risk and confusion.
Establishing a structured review cadence is essential to keep the dictionary updated. This cadence can be monthly, quarterly, or aligned with development sprints or data governance meetings. The key is making reviews a routine, not a reaction to issues.
Without this structure, teams often discover outdated definitions only after inconsistencies surface in reporting or when a regulatory audit demands metadata transparency.
Best practices for review cadence include:
-
Creating review workflows with defined roles, responsibilities, and escalation paths.
-
Prioritizing high-impact or frequently used fields for more frequent validation.
-
Establishing cross-functional metadata councils for complex or shared data domains.
-
Documenting each review with a timestamp and decision log to support audits and institutional memory.
When reviews are consistently executed, the data dictionary becomes a reliable source of truth rather than an outdated artifact.
2. Automate metadata updates and keep systems in sync
As data platforms, pipelines, and schemas evolve, manual documentation can cause serious problems, from broken reports to compliance failures, especially in highly regulated industries. Automation is essential for keeping the data dictionary current and minimizing the burden on human stewards.
This includes capturing field names, data types, table relationships, and lineage across systems. When metadata is kept in sync automatically, discrepancies can be flagged early.
|
For example, if a field is renamed or dropped in a source system but remains referenced in reporting or dashboards, automation can trigger an alert before the issue impacts decision-making or customer-facing analytics. |
Automation alone is not enough, however. It must be combined with human validation to ensure the business meaning of a field remains accurate.
While scripts can detect schema changes, only people can determine whether a new field should replace an old one or if a transformation logic change affects how a metric should be interpreted.
Maintaining synchronization between systems and the data dictionary supports long-term sustainability by eliminating the technical debt that accumulates when documentation fails to keep pace with system evolution.
3. Audit, validate, and continuously improve data quality
Routine audits are a critical part of maintaining the integrity and usefulness of a data dictionary.
According to a 2025 IBM Research Report on Data Quality, nearly half (49%) of executives cite data inaccuracies and bias as a barrier to technology adoption.
At scale, spreadsheet-based data dictionaries fail for structural reasons. Definitions drift as systems change, and there is no reliable way to keep documentation synchronized with live data.
Platforms like OvalEdge address this gap by binding definitions directly to metadata, lineage, and change events, ensuring the documentation reflects real-time system behavior.
To perform an effective audit:
-
Compare dictionary entries against live database schemas to identify undocumented or deprecated fields.
-
Validate that field definitions are complete, with clear names, data types, calculation logic, business context, and usage guidance.
-
Check for consistency in naming conventions and formatting across domains and systems.
-
Review ownership metadata to ensure that each definition has a current, accountable steward.
However, audits alone are not enough. A high-quality data dictionary thrives on active collaboration. When users can easily report unclear terms or suggest new entries, the dictionary evolves in response to actual business needs.
Enable this by:
-
Embedding feedback forms or comment features directly in the data dictionary interface.
-
Creating a lightweight intake process for term clarification or enhancement requests.
-
Prioritizing fixes or improvements based on usage frequency and business impact.
-
Sharing audit outcomes with stakeholders to foster transparency and encourage engagement.
Ultimately, consistent audits and open feedback channels are not just documentation hygiene. They are strategic levers for enabling better decisions, minimizing risk, and reinforcing data governance throughout the enterprise.
Data dictionary management tips for scaling organizations
As organizations grow, data complexity grows with them. New teams, new systems, and new priorities multiply the number of data sources and definitions in circulation.
Without deliberate structure and visibility, the data dictionary can become fragmented, underutilized, or ignored, leading to confusion, redundant work, and poor data quality.
For scaling environments, strong data dictionary practices are essential to maintain clarity and drive alignment across all levels of the organization.

1. Enable cross-team collaboration through shared definitions and clear access
Cross-functional collaboration often breaks down due to inconsistent terminology. A metric like “conversion rate” can mean different things to marketing, sales, and product teams unless there is a single, shared definition documented and agreed upon.
Making the dictionary truly collaborative means:
-
Assigning co-ownership of terms where multiple domains intersect, such as revenue metrics or customer segmentation.
-
Establishing a process for reviewing and approving new definitions through a data council or governance group.
-
Enabling commenting or feedback features to allow business users to flag unclear terms or suggest improvements.
-
Providing permissioned access that allows technical teams to update schemas while business users contribute narrative context or usage notes.
As organizations scale, the goal is not just to document definitions, but to create a culture of shared language and understanding. A data dictionary that is widely adopted and collaboratively maintained becomes a powerful bridge between teams, reducing rework and improving decision-making.
2. Integrate the data dictionary with data catalogs and BI tools
Data definitions are often siloed in spreadsheets, slide decks, or tribal knowledge, making it difficult for users to know where to look or which version to trust.
When definitions are embedded into reporting tools like Tableau, Power BI, or Looker, analysts and business stakeholders can quickly understand the meaning, lineage, and ownership of each field without having to search elsewhere.
This supports real-time comprehension and reduces reliance on internal clarifications or outdated documentation.
Integration with data catalogs further enhances discoverability and control. Catalogs can serve as the metadata backbone, linking the dictionary to upstream systems, ETL pipelines, and downstream analytics.
This creates end-to-end visibility and enables features like:
-
Lineage tracking to understand how a data field flows across systems and reports.
-
Impact analysis to assess what happens when a field is modified or deprecated.
-
Policy enforcement to flag unapproved terms or undocumented fields before they reach production.
To execute this well:
-
Map your dictionary fields to physical data assets across platforms.
-
Establish two-way syncs between your dictionary and data catalog to keep definitions and schemas aligned.
-
Use embedded tooltips or field descriptions in BI dashboards to surface key metadata inline.
-
Encourage teams to document not just what data is, but how and why it’s used in different business contexts.
By embedding the dictionary into the tools people use daily, users make faster, more informed decisions because they don’t just see the data; they understand it. In a scaling environment, this level of embedded clarity becomes a competitive advantage for data governance, operational efficiency, and cross-team trust.
3. Create tiered documentation for technical and business users
A well-structured data dictionary must serve diverse audiences, from data engineers working on pipelines to business users analyzing performance metrics.
One-size-fits-all documentation creates friction, either by overwhelming non-technical users with schema-level metadata or by leaving technical teams with vague, context-light definitions. To avoid this disconnect, tiered documentation is essential.
|
For example, a field like user_status_code might be defined in the technical layer as a VARCHAR(3) pulled from a CRM source system. But the business-facing definition should explain what each code means (e.g., "ACT" = active customer, "CHU" = churned), how it's typically used in reporting, and what business questions it supports. |
Practical steps for effective tiered documentation include:
-
Structuring each entry with separate sections for technical attributes (e.g., data type, nullability, default values, source system) and business context (e.g., meaning, usage scenarios, reporting caveats).
-
Creating cross-references between technical fields and business glossary terms. For instance, tie revenue_flag to a definition of “Recognized Revenue” in the business glossary.
-
Exposing the right level of documentation and context in BI tools, data catalogs, or notebooks. Engineers should see technical specs in schema registries or source control, while analysts should see business definitions in dashboards.
-
Assigning domain-specific stewards. Technical stewards should maintain schema accuracy, while business stewards are accountable for contextual clarity. This dual stewardship ensures each tier remains current and relevant.
When layered well, the data dictionary becomes more than a repository of field names. It becomes an authoritative reference that connects business outcomes to technical design, supporting data governance, compliance, and decision-making in equal measure.
4. Monitor usage patterns and optimize for high-value data assets
In scaling data environments, not all data fields carry equal weight. Some are referenced daily in dashboards, reports, or compliance filings, while others may be rarely accessed or outdated.
Monitoring how data definitions are consumed allows teams to prioritize maintenance and documentation efforts based on real business impact, rather than applying a one-size-fits-all approach.
Start by tracking user interactions with your data dictionary. This includes which definitions are viewed most frequently, how often terms are edited or flagged, and which fields are linked to high-traffic dashboards or core reports. These signals help identify which assets are business-critical and also surface hidden risks.
To operationalize this:
-
Implement logging and analytics within your data dictionary platform to monitor term-level engagement.
-
Correlate frequently accessed terms with business KPIs or compliance-critical reports.
-
Create review tiers that flag high-usage terms for more frequent validation cycles.
-
Use popularity metrics to inform training, documentation updates, or data governance discussions.
This optimization approach supports both scalability and efficiency. Rather than spreading stewardship resources thin across hundreds or thousands of entries, teams can focus on the data elements that drive the most business value.
Conclusion
A great data dictionary doesn't just document fields. It empowers teams, enhances trust, and turns data into a shared language across your organization. When done right, it supports governance, reduces risk, and drives faster, smarter decisions.
The best time to start building or improving your data dictionary is today. Begin with what matters most, including clarity, ownership, and collaboration. Then expand.
As you grow, your dictionary becomes more than documentation. It becomes the foundation for reliable, data-driven growth.
So ask yourself. What definition in your organization is still unclear? What report do you question every time you open it? Start there and build your way to trust.
Wondering where to start?
Book a demo with OvalEdge today to understand how to build a scalable, intuitive data dictionary that delivers trust, consistency, and clarity from day one.
FAQs
1. What is the main purpose of a data dictionary?
To provide a shared, authoritative reference that explains what data means, how it should be used, and who is responsible for it.
2. How do I build an effective data dictionary?
An effective data dictionary starts with identifying high-impact data elements, defining each field with business context, calculation logic, and usage guidance, and assigning clear ownership. Integrating automation for metadata capture and version control ensures it remains accurate and scalable.
3. Why is a data dictionary important for data governance?
A well-maintained data dictionary standardizes definitions across teams, supports audit readiness, ensures compliance, and minimizes the risk of misinterpretation. It acts as a single source of truth, promoting alignment between business and technical stakeholders.
4. How do I keep a data dictionary up to date?
To keep a data dictionary up to date, automate metadata syncing with source systems, assign stewardship for manual review, and establish a review cadence. Monitoring usage patterns and implementing feedback loops also help prioritize updates and ensure definitions reflect real-world usage.
5. What tools are used to manage data dictionaries?
Organizations use data catalogs, metadata management tools, and integrations with BI platforms to manage data dictionaries. These tools enable metadata automation, version tracking, lineage visualization, and embedding definitions directly into analytics workflows.
6. What are the benefits of standardized data definitions?
Standardized definitions eliminate ambiguity, reduce rework, and ensure consistent reporting across teams. This enhances collaboration, improves trust in data, and streamlines compliance by making data meaningful and transparent and traceable across systems.
Deep-dive whitepapers on modern data governance and agentic analytics
OvalEdge recognized as a leader in data governance solutions
“Reference customers have repeatedly mentioned the great customer service they receive along with the support for their custom requirements, facilitating time to value. OvalEdge fits well with organizations prioritizing business user empowerment within their data governance strategy.”
“Reference customers have repeatedly mentioned the great customer service they receive along with the support for their custom requirements, facilitating time to value. OvalEdge fits well with organizations prioritizing business user empowerment within their data governance strategy.”
Gartner, Magic Quadrant for Data and Analytics Governance Platforms, January 2025
Gartner does not endorse any vendor, product or service depicted in its research publications, and does not advise technology users to select only those vendors with the highest ratings or other designation. Gartner research publications consist of the opinions of Gartner’s research organization and should not be construed as statements of fact. Gartner disclaims all warranties, expressed or implied, with respect to this research, including any warranties of merchantability or fitness for a particular purpose.
GARTNER and MAGIC QUADRANT are registered trademarks of Gartner, Inc. and/or its affiliates in the U.S. and internationally and are used herein with permission. All rights reserved.

